Monterey Bay Kayaks

Basic Skills for Sit on Top Kayaks
If you want to use a sit-on-top kayak for coastal trips, this class is a great investment towards making your adventures safe and enjoyable This class combines the Intro to Kayaks and Surf Zone for a comprehesive and intensive fun day. Includes wetsuit, sit-on-top single kayak and all gear. Instructors are ACA trained.

Offered every Sunday 9:00 to 5:00
Price per Person: $110.00



Intro to Sea Kayaking
Learn the ABC's of sea kayaking in the calm harbor while seals and sea otters look on. This class covers proper fit, balance and basic strokes to enhance your stability in a single kayak. Then learn how to control your kayak, prevent a capsize and other safety issues that will increase your confidence on the water. Your choice of open deck or closed deck kayaks. Includes wetsuit, kayaks and all gear

Offered every Saturday and Sunday 9:00 - 1:00.
Price per Person: $60.00


Surf Zone
Learn how to launch and land from beaches with surf with style and grace. Bracing and other skills learned in the surf zone are essential for controlling your boat in rougher, open water conditions. This class will also review various capsize recovery techniques. Prerequisites: EITHER Intro to Sea Kayaking AND Re-Entry and Rescues OR Basic Skills for Touring Kayaks OR Basic Skills for Sit on Top Kayaks OR equivalent instruction. Includes wetsuit, all gear and kayak. Instructors are ACA trained.

Offered every second Saturday and every Sunday 2:00 - 5:00
Price per Person: $75.00

Here is where I usually check the weather for the Monterey area.  Point and click on the map and you can get a forecast for just about any launch:  http://forecast.weather.gov/MapClick.php?lat=36.615527631349245&lon=-121.87030792236328&site=mtr&unit=0&lg=en
This is about where MBK is, and currently the forecast is:

Sunday: Variable winds less than 5 kt becoming W 5 to 8 kt in the morning. Sunny. Mixed swell...W 3 ft and SSW 2 ft. Wind waves around 1 ft.

That may sound scary, but that is really a great forecast and the launch should be like a swimming pool.  If I wasn't going to BSSII this weekend, I'd probably be out there in Monterey trying my luck at Salmon!   :smt003 Keep an eye on it, I'm going to guess that the forecast will improve even more by Friday  :smt002
